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Identify the source of the water and assess the extent of the damage. This is crucial in determining the best course of action for your carpet pad water extraction.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Use specialized equipment to remove the water from the carpet pad. This may involve using a wet vacuum or a submersible pump to extract the water.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Use industrial-grade fans and dehumidifiers to dry out the carpet pad and surrounding areas. This helps prevent further damage and promotes a safe and healthy environment.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fecting
Thoroughly clean and disinfect the affected areas to prevent the growth of mold and mildew. This is especially important in areas where water has been present.
Step 5: Restoration and Repair
Restore your carpet pad to its original condition by repairing or replacing any damaged areas. This may involve installing new carpet or padding to ensure your floor is safe and secure.

Carpet Pad Water Extraction Cost In Burien, WA
The cost of carpet pad water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Burien, WA. These are estimates, not guarantees, and the actual cost may be higher or lower.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Planning | $100 – $500 | The extent of the damage and the complexity of the job. |
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| The amount of water present and the difficulty of access.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the level of humidity. |
| Cleaning and Disinfecting | $200 – $1,000 | The extent of the damage and the level of contamination. |
| Restoration and Rep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the damage and the complexity of the repair. |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ment, we offer free estimates to help you understand the cost of our services.
